Here is a short list of why I adore this trim so much:

1)      It’s puffy – That means dimension on your page without even trying.  And we all love a little dimension, don’t we?

2)      It’s sequined – I don’t really think I need to elaborate here…right?  It sparkles, it shines, it makes me smile.

3)      It’s self-adhesive – I’m a sucker for an embellishment with a good adhesive backing.  It cuts out a step and makes life easier somehow.  Le sigh.

4)      It’s a heart – Quite possibly my favorite shape ever.  I love using it on my pages and projects because I {heart} the subject of my pages so much.  Te he he.

5)      It’s versatile – You can use it all strung together as trim or cut it apart into individual little pieces of loveliness.
